ADVERTISEMENT FOR BIDS

EAST PARKING LOT – SOUTH END CONSTRUCTION

CONTRACT 2012-0001

Sealed Bids for the East Parking Lot – South End, will be received by the City of Three Rivers, at the City Hall, 333 W. Michigan Avenue, Three Rivers, MI 49093, until 11:00 am, local time, on Tuesday August 14, 2012 at which time they will be publicly opened and read.

In general, the work consists of excavation and grading in preparation of concrete curb and gutter, asphalt pavement, and concrete sidewalk for a new parking lot. Pavement striping will also be included in the project.

Copies of the Bidding Documents may be examined and purchased at the Department of Public Services 1015 S. Lincoln Avenue, Three Rivers, MI 49093, or e-mailed at no cost from the Department.

Technical questions regarding the project should be faxed to the Public Services Director at the City of Three Rivers (269-273-1042)

The Owner has no responsibility for the accuracy, completeness or sufficiency of any bid documents obtained from any source other than the source indicated in these documents. Obtaining these documents from any other source(s) may result in obtaining incomplete and inaccurate information. Obtaining these documents from any source other than directly from the source listed herein may also result in failure to receive any addenda, corrections, or other revisions to these documents that may be issued.

Bids must be submitted on the forms bound herein, must contain the names of every person or company interested therein, and shall be accompanied by a Bid Bond in the amount of 5% of the amount bid with satisfactory corporate surety, subject to conditions provided in the Instructions to Bidders. The successful bidder will be required to furnish satisfactory Performance Bond and Maintenance and guarantee Bond in the amount of 100% of the Bid, and Labor and Material Bond in the amount of 50% of the Bid.

Any Bid may be withdrawn prior to the scheduled closing time for receipt of Bids, but no bidder shall withdraw his Bid within 45 days after the actual opening thereof.

The Owner reserves the right to reject any or all Bids, waive irregularities in any Bid, and to accept any Bid which is deemed most favorable to the Owner.
